View Issue Details

This bug affects 1 person(s).
 6
IDProjectCategoryView StatusLast Update
09560Bug reportsSurvey participants (Tokens)public2015-05-08 09:16
Reporterpcerny Assigned ToDenisChenu  
PrioritynormalSeverityminor 
Status closedResolutionfixed 
Product Version2.05+ 
Target Version2.06+Fixed in Version2.05+ 
Summary09560: "Bounce settings" changeable although "Use global settings" were chosen
Description

In current version (Version 2.05+ Build 150211) - "Bounce settings" fields at /index.php/admin/tokens/sa/bouncesettings/surveyid/XXXXXX can be stil changed, although you choose "Use global settings".

In older build (Version 2.05+ Build 140915) "Bounce settings" fields changed to grey when you select "Use global settings" - which is much better.

Screenshots at http://1drv.ms/1NJJrRU.

Steps To Reproduce

In current version (Version 2.05+ Build 150211) go to Token management, then "Bounce settings", select "Use global settings".
Direct link: xxxxxxxx/index.php/admin/tokens/sa/bouncesettings/surveyid/XXXXXX.

TagsNo tags attached.
Attached Files
Clipboard01c.png (83,356 bytes)   
Clipboard01c.png (83,356 bytes)   
Bug heat6
Complete LimeSurvey version number (& build)150211
I will donate to the project if issue is resolvedNo
Browserfirefox, chrome
Database type & versionmysql 5
Server OS (if known)apache
Webserver software & version (if known)--
PHP Version5.3.29-pl0-gentoo

Relationships

child of 09320 closedDenisChenu Unable to edit local the bounce parameters in token management 

Users monitoring this issue

There are no users monitoring this issue.

Activities

DenisChenu

DenisChenu

2015-03-12 15:44

developer   ~31810

Yes, and ?
You can change ir and it's not used, then : what is the problem ?

DenisChenu

DenisChenu

2015-03-12 15:45

developer   ~31811

Last edited: 2015-03-12 15:47

PS: your screenshot need a login ....

PS: it's NOT better : why delete user information ?

Example:

  • Set own bounce setting (selecting Survey bounce)
  • It's OK : woking
  • select global : save (by error)
  • Return to bounce setting : Information is lost .

Actually we don't lost information : really much better.

pcerny

pcerny

2015-03-12 16:57

reporter   ~31813

Image uploaded above.

I understand your example.

I have another one, for me more frequent: we use "global settings" for bounced emails. So survey administrators for every new survey select "Use global settings", and then is much better when all other fields change to grey and for administrators si clear, that all settings are well done now. This way it worked in older builds.

In the current version, after you select "Use global settings", all below fields (Server, Username etc) are still active and it looks you should fill them, although these fields will not be (hopefully) used in bounced emails analysis.

DenisChenu

DenisChenu

2015-03-31 13:15

developer   ~31930

Fix committed to master branch: http://bugs.limesurvey.org/plugin.php?page=Source/view&id=15061

DenisChenu

DenisChenu

2015-04-01 11:21

developer   ~31936

Fix committed to 2.06 branch: http://bugs.limesurvey.org/plugin.php?page=Source/view&id=15066

c_schmitz

c_schmitz

2015-05-08 09:16

administrator   ~32122

2.05+ Build 150508 released

Related Changesets

LimeSurvey: master cd6d0efc

2015-03-31 11:15:03

DenisChenu

Details Diff
Fixed issue 09560: "Bounce settings" changeable although "Use global settings" were chosen
Dev: really prefer to allow updating but ...
Dev: Review it for 2.06 (using of extension)
Affected Issues
09560
mod - application/views/admin/token/bounce.php Diff File
add - scripts/admin/tokenbounce.js Diff File

LimeSurvey: 2.06 fda369eb

2015-04-01 09:21:26

DenisChenu

Details Diff
Fixed issue 09560: "Bounce settings" changeable although "Use global settings" were chosen
Dev: really prefer to allow updating but ...
Dev: Usage of extension for form
Affected Issues
09560
mod - application/controllers/admin/tokens.php Diff File
mod - application/views/admin/token/bounce.php Diff File
add - scripts/admin/tokenbounce.js Diff File

Issue History

Date Modified Username Field Change
2015-03-11 15:22 pcerny New Issue
2015-03-12 15:44 DenisChenu Note Added: 31810
2015-03-12 15:44 DenisChenu Assigned To => DenisChenu
2015-03-12 15:44 DenisChenu Status new => assigned
2015-03-12 15:45 DenisChenu Note Added: 31811
2015-03-12 15:47 DenisChenu Note Edited: 31811
2015-03-12 16:39 pcerny File Added: Clipboard01c.png
2015-03-12 16:57 pcerny Note Added: 31813
2015-03-12 18:54 DenisChenu Target Version => 2.06+
2015-03-31 12:27 DenisChenu Relationship added child of 09320
2015-03-31 13:15 DenisChenu Changeset attached => LimeSurvey master cd6d0efc
2015-03-31 13:15 DenisChenu Note Added: 31930
2015-03-31 13:15 DenisChenu Resolution open => fixed
2015-04-01 11:21 DenisChenu Changeset attached => LimeSurvey 2.06 fda369eb
2015-04-01 11:21 DenisChenu Note Added: 31936
2015-04-01 11:22 DenisChenu Status assigned => resolved
2015-04-01 11:22 DenisChenu Fixed in Version => 2.05+
2015-05-08 09:16 c_schmitz Note Added: 32122
2015-05-08 09:16 c_schmitz Status resolved => closed
2016-12-08 10:39 c_schmitz Category Tokens => Survey participants (Tokens)